Cameral Club Prizes Awarded.

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

Prizes and honorable mentions have been awarded as follows in the Camera Club exhibit now being held in Robinson Hall: first prize--group by T. W. Sears '07; second prize--group by M. S. McN. Watts 1G.; honorable mentions--"Fitting for the Banks" and "Prey of the Sea," by M. D. Miller 4M; "The River Road," by V. H. McCutcheon '07; "An Austrian Farmyard," by K. G. Carpenter '08; "The Old Spring House," by E. S. Bryant '06.

The judges were Mr. F. W. Day, of Boston, and Mr. P. P. Sharples '95, of Cambridge.

The exhibition will be open to the public daily until next Thursday from 8 A. M. to 6 P. M., and will also be open tonight and on Monday evening.
